R:='integrate(sinh(x),x,-inf,inf)
R,integrate; says principal value, 0. That's good.
If you change the variable, eg. changevar(R,x=t+1,t,x) you get
integrate(sinh(t+1),t,-inf-1,inf); I would hope to simplify -inf-1 to
-inf, and there is a program, namely limit that does it. Limit(-inf-1) -->
inf.
However, limit ( the_integral...) doesn't do the job. That is, the -inf-1
in the lower limit stays there.
But the integral from -inf to inf of sinh(t+1) diverges. Maybe this is the
right math answer?
For what it is worth, Mathematica 6.0 does not get R above, correct, even if
you say to find Principal Value.
